Understanding an Organic Waste Composting Machine
An organic waste composting machine is a machine that has been engineered to convert organic waste into compost through a biological decomposing process. While the normal composting process takes several months to achieve results, the machine performs this function in a few days while ensuring hygiene and efficiency. The organic waste composter ensures the right temperature, moisture, and air availability for the microorganisms to decompose the organic waste.
The advanced composting machine is best suited for organic wastes like food wastes, vegetable wastes, fruit wastes, garden waste, and other biodegradable materials. Several organizations have been using the waste compost bin to collect waste material before processing it through the machine.
How Does an Organic Waste Composting Machine Work?
Process of Working of Organic Waste Composting Machine: The organic waste composting machine has its own working mechanism through which the biodegradable wastes are collected and processed. Initially, the biodegradable waste is collected in the waste compost bin. Later, the organic waste composter is fed with the waste, where processes like shredding, mixing, aeration, and microbial decomposition are carried out.
In the process of composting, the organic waste composter mixes the waste regularly to generate uniform compost. The compost generated through this machine is nutrient-rich, odorless, and useful for agricultural and gardening purposes.
Types of Organic Waste Composting Machines
Different kinds of organic waste composting machines are available in different models to suit different levels of organic waste generation capacity. Small capacity organic waste composting machines are best suited for use at home, apartment complexes, and schools. Medium-capacity food waste composting machines are mostly used in hotels, restaurants, hospitals, and offices.
Large capacity industrial composting machines are meant for use by cities, food processing factories, and other waste management facilities. Most of the facilities also have a waste compost bin system to segregate waste prior to composting. The capacity chosen will be dependent on the level of organic waste generated daily.

Organic Waste Composting Process
The first step in the process of composting involves the gathering of biodegradable waste from the kitchen, gardens, restaurants, and food processing industries. This process involves segregation of waste, followed by the removal of plastics, metals, and other non-biodegradable waste. The segregated waste is then collected in the storage bin and taken to the composting chamber.
The process of composting involves continuous mixing and aeration for maintaining the proper levels of oxygen, while controlling the temperature and moisture of the waste. Within days, the waste material becomes nutrient-rich organic compost.

Maintenance Tips for Organic Waste Composting Machines
Regular maintenance ensures consistent compost quality and extends machine life. Operators should clean the machine periodically, inspect moving parts, monitor moisture levels, and ensure proper microbial culture is added whenever required. Routine servicing helps prevent unexpected breakdowns while maintaining optimal composting performance. Proper waste segregation before processing also improves efficiency and reduces wear on machine components.
